Transaction 88515ae0ffcda44b7ba052452f71398ba18664f67e9d020b2e8756696b9c407a
1 Input
1 Output
-
88515ae0ffcda44b7ba052452f71398ba18664f67e9d020b2e8756696b9c407a:0
- value
- 30998187
- script pubkey
- OP_HASH160 OP_PUSHBYTES_20 3bb65525234cb813301a2e9afec14d880b044962 OP_EQUAL
- address
- MDLtXSRfigspEeHpf9fxdY3kZV4bJkMRqh